General recommendation: 600-1200mg aged garlic extract daily, or 180mg allicin daily
Timing: Divide into 2 doses (morning and evening) for sustained effect • Take with food for best absorption.
| Condition | Recommended Dose | Evidence |
|---|---|---|
| High blood pressure | 600-900mg AGE daily (or 480mg allicin) | Strong |
| Cholesterol management | 600-1200mg AGE daily | Moderate |
| Arterial calcification | 2400mg AGE daily | Moderate |
| General cardiovascular health | 600mg AGE daily | Strong |
Upper limit: 2400mg AGE/day (well-tolerated in clinical trials)
Divide into 2 doses (morning and evening) for sustained effect
Best taken with food for optimal absorption.
